Structural Elements of Fort Reinforcements
Structural elements of fort reinforcements are foundational to enhancing the durability and resilience of colonial forts. Reinforced walls and ramparts, constructed with a combination of stone, brick, and earth, provide a robust barrier against invaders. These materials were strategically chosen for their strength and availability.
Additional structural features include moats and ditches, which serve as natural obstacles to impede enemy approach. These elements are often paired with elevated platforms and firing positions, allowing defenders to monitor and respond to threats more effectively. Their design was critical in extending the defensive perimeter.
The incorporation of bastions and hornworks reflects a focus on tactical advantage. Bastions enable flanking fire, covering blind spots in the walls, while hornworks act as auxiliary defenses. These reinforcements improved the fort’s ability to withstand prolonged sieges and coordinated assaults.

Deployment of protective cover and barriers
The deployment of protective cover and barriers was a critical element in reinforcing colonial forts, significantly enhancing their defensive capabilities. These measures aimed to shield troops and vital structures from enemy fire and natural elements. Protective covers often included strategically positioned earthworks, wooden palisades, and reinforced parapets designed to absorb or deflect incoming projectiles.
Barriers such as chevaux-de-frise, re-entrant walls, and layered ditches provided additional lines of defense, complicating enemy assaults. These structures not only limited access routes but also allowed defenders to maintain a defensive advantage during sieges. The integration of natural barriers, like water moats or swampy terrain, further augmented these protective measures, making direct attack more challenging.
Overall, deploying protective cover and barriers was essential for transforming colonial forts into formidable strongholds. These additions increased survivability and allowed defenders to sustain prolonged resistance, even under intense assault. Their strategic implementation underscores the importance of layered defenses in fort reinforcement efforts.

Challenges and Limitations of Reinforcing Colonial Forts
Reinforcing colonial forts posed several significant challenges and limitations. One primary issue was the scarcity of suitable materials for durable upgrades, which often limited the extent and quality of fortifications. Many colonial regions lacked access to advanced construction resources, hindering effective reinforcement efforts.
Another challenge was the logistical difficulty of transporting heavy materials and artillery components over rough terrains. These constraints increased construction time and costs, often delaying fort upgrade projects and limiting their timely completion during periods of conflict.
Additionally, the integration of new defensive technologies within existing structures frequently encountered structural limitations. Older fort designs were not always adaptable to modern weaponry or reinforcement techniques, necessitating costly and extensive modifications that were sometimes structurally unfeasible.
Finally, resource allocation and prioritization limited reinforcement efforts. Colonial authorities often had to balance military upgrades against other pressing needs, such as establishing settlements or managing local populations, which could impede ongoing fort reinforcement and upgrades.
